
Fender Musical Instruments Corporation (FMIC) today announces the launch of the Vintera II Series. This latest addition to Fender’s historic portfolio of electric guitars marks a significant update to the original debut of the Vintera Series. This new line of vibrant and highly playable guitars pay homage to the iconic Stratยฎand Teleยฎ guitars of the 50s, 60s and 70s while simultaneously nodding to some of the rare gems that have studded the Fender lineup such as the Mustangยฎ and Bass VI. Fender’s Vintera II Series offers era-correct neck shapes that deliver a worn-in, super-comfortable feel, reflecting Fender’s most classic neck designs for an exceptional playing experience. The series also includes vintage-voiced pickups, allowing players to capture the authentic sound of bygone eras. Adding to its allure, the Vintera II lineup introduces some of the rarest custom colors ever produced by Fender. Alongside these features, the series showcases all-new models like the Bass VI, Teleยฎ Deluxe with Tremolo and a maple-neck Mustangยฎ, catering to the preferences of even the most seasoned collectors.

Vintera II โ60s Bass VI ($1,399.99 USD)
The Vintera II โ60s Bass VI features an alder body and a maple neck for classic Fender tone thatโs full of punch and clarity. The mid-โ60s โCโ-shape neck lends a comfortably familiar grip that feels just right in your hand, while the 7.25โ radius fingerboard with vintage-tall frets provide vintage comfort with ample room for big bends and expressive vibrato. Under the hood, youโll find a trio of vintage-style early โ60s single-coil pickups that deliver all the sweet and sparkling, warm and woody tone that made Fender famous. The vintage-style floating tremolo lets you dive and wail with abandon, while vintage-style tuning machines provide classic looks with a finer gear ratio and enhanced tuning stability to complete the package.

Vintera II โ70s Mustang Bass ($1,179.99 USD)
The Vintera II โ70s Mustangยฎ Bass features an alder body and a maple neck with rosewood fingerboard for classic Fender tone thatโs full of punch and clarity. The early โ70s โCโ-shape neck is based on a classic โ70s profile for an intuitive and inviting feel, while the 7.25โ radius fingerboard with vintage-tall frets provide vintage comfort with ample room for big bends and expressive vibrato. Under the hood, the vintage-style โ70s split-coil delivers the iconic Fender sound: warm, woody, dynamic and powerful. The vintage-style 4-saddle bridge and tuning machines provide classic looks with enhanced intonation and tuning stability to complete the package.
